- What's the difference between conventional and significant-ratio mortgages? A conventional mortgage can be a mortgage personal loan nearly a utmost of 80% of the lending price of the property. Which means that the house purchaser has produced a down payment of at least 20% of the acquisition price tag or industry price of the home.
